The evolution of the microstructure in various stages of plastic deformation under quasi-static tension of titanium specimens in the coarse-grain (CG) and ultrafine-grained (UFG) states, as well as their thermal diffusivity and heat capacity, have been studied. New experimental data have been obtained indicating a significant effect of the UFG structure on the development of plastic deformation and fracture processes and the thermophysical characteristics titanium.
